About Yan‐Jie Xue
Yan‐Jie Xue is a scholar working on Astronomy and Astrophysics, Nuclear and High Energy Physics and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 12 papers that have together received 328 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Galaxies: Formation, Evolution, Phenomena (8 papers), Astrophysics and Star Formation Studies (4 papers) and Cosmology and Gravitation Theories (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Instrumentation (101 citations), Astronomy and Astrophysics (319 citations) and Nuclear and High Energy Physics (91 citations). Yan‐Jie Xue has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Taiwan. Frequent co-authors include Xiangping Wu, Li‐Zhi Fang, Tzihong Chiueh, Le Shao, Shaorong Wang, Jiqin Qian, Jing Xu, Jinzhong Liu, Xu Zhou and Ali Esamdin. Their work appears in journals such as The Astrophysical Journal, Monthly Notices of the Royal Astronomical Society and ECS Transactions.
